CORVALLIS, Ore. – Oregon Tech claimed the 2021-22 Cascade Collegiate Conference All-Sport title, the conference announced Friday. The Owls slightly edged out the College of Idaho for their second-straight and second overall title.
Oregon Tech earned first-place points with regular-season championships in women’s soccer and softball, while also splitting points as co-champions in men’s soccer with Warner Pacific University. OIT racked up key points with second-place finishes in men’s basketball, men’s golf, and women’s golf, helping the Owls tally 198.6 points.
The College of Idaho, with 198.2 points, were the runners-up for the second year in a row on the strength of first-place points in men’s basketball, men’s cross country and women’s cross country. The Yotes also earned second-place points in men’s track/field.
Southern Oregon University, Lewis-Clark State College and Eastern Oregon University round out the top five with 193.7, 186.5 and 182.06 points, respectively. SOU earned second-place points in women’s soccer, women’s cross country, women’s basketball and women’s wrestling, while LC State stood atop the women’s basketball and baseball podium. EOU earned first-place points in men’s wrestling and men’s track/field.
